Grasping Umbrella Company Structures in Relation to IR35

Umbrella companies have emerged as a common structure for independent contractors within the UK, particularly in sectors such as IT. These entities function by employing contractors and then supplying them to various clients on short-term assignments. Nevertheless, the advent of IR35 legislation has brought significant complexity to this arrangement, aiming to ensure that contractors operating through umbrella companies are correctly classified for tax purposes. IR35 seeks to prevent individuals from being treated as self-employed while effectively working like employees, thereby ensuring they pay the appropriate level of national insurance and income tax.

  • Consequently, it is crucial for contractors to understand the intricate relationship between umbrella company structures and IR35 legislation.
  • This involves meticulously evaluating their working practices, contracts, and the specific arrangements offered by the umbrella company they choose to work with.

Navigating IR35: Umbrella Companies and Contractors

Within the complex landscape regarding IR35 legislation, umbrella companies play a crucial role in ensuring contractor compliance. By acting as an intermediary between contractors and clients, they help to streamline compensation and manage the administrative burdens associated with IR35. Umbrella companies typically handle tasks such as calculating deductions, processing PAYE, and ensuring contractors satisfy their legal Ir35 duties. This can ease the stress on contractors, allowing them to devote their efforts to their core expertise.

  • Moreover, umbrella companies often extend valuable advice to contractors on IR35 issues. This can include information about contract types and the latest legislation, helping contractors to make informed decisions about their projects.

Understanding Tax Implications and Responsibilities: Umbrella Companies and IR35

When engaging as a contractor in the UK, it's essential to grasp the complexities of tax implications. Two key factors that often come into play are umbrella companies and IR35. Umbrella companies offer a organized framework for contractors, handling payment processing and financial compliance. IR35, on the other hand, is a set of legislation designed to prevent tax avoidance by individuals who engage through their own sole proprietorships.

Understanding the relationship between these two elements is critical for contractors to confirm they are satisfying their tax obligations. Neglect to do so can result in fines, including back taxes and interest charges.

  • Seeking professional counsel from an accountant or tax specialist is highly suggested for contractors to navigate the complexities of umbrella companies and IR35.
